Grants Boost Livability in Montana Communities

A pickleball paddle and balls resting by the net on a blue court, ready for a game. 3d rendering
GETTY IMAGES

Eight Montana locales are receiving funding this year from AARP Community Challenge grants.

The grants in Montana total $83,255 for projects that range from improving accessibility at public places to enhancing outdoor sports amenities.

Among the recipients:

  • The city of Dillon: Seasonally themed, high-visibility crosswalks around Jaycee Park.
  • The city of Glasgow: An outdoor fitness court next to the city hospital.
  • Missoula in Motion: Two street murals, helping to promote pedestrian safety.
  • Plains Pickleball Association: Courtside amenities at two new pickleball courts.
